HOLMER WI celebrated its 75th birthday in May and marked the occasion by changing its meeting venue for the first time.
Formed in 1941 at the height of the Second World War, the ladies met in what was then an old tin hut next to Holmer Parish Church more recently replaced by a modern church centre. Now, with membership increasing the WI starts its new era at St Mary's Church on Grandstand Road.
Members celebrated the landmark with a special Sunday lunch at Burghill Golf Club when the two longest serving members, Margaret Hartland, 56 years and Kath Lambert, 53 years, presented president Jenny Hare and treasurer Jane Jenkins with bouquets. At the May 4 meeting members enjoyed the traditional birthday cake, baked by WI member Frances Riddell.
Holmer WI meets on the first Wednesday of each month (7.30pm) at St Marys Church, Grandstand Road and welcomes new members.
